Impressive Design and Specifications

The Viaggio Chandelier boasts an impressive size of 100.3"L x 30.2"W x 40.3"H, providing ample illumination and creating a striking visual impact. Its opal glass shades exude a soft, soothing glow, making it perfect for enhancing the ambiance of your living room, dining area, or bedroom.
